Key Factors

sports_soccer 1

Mexico has already secured 1st place in Group A, allowing for squad rotation, while Czechia is in a 'must-win' situation to advance, creating a clash of motivation levels.

trending_up 2

The match is played at Estadio Azteca in Mexico City; the high altitude (2,240m) and 100,000-capacity home crowd provide a massive physical and psychological advantage for 'El Tri'.

person 3

Mexico's defense has been elite this tournament, keeping two clean sheets with an average xG against of 0.85, whereas Czechia has struggled for efficiency despite high shot volumes (1.75 xG vs South Africa, only 1 goal scored).

medical_services

Injuries & Absentees

Czechia is significantly weakened on the left flank by the loss of David Jurásek (thigh injury), which limits their overlapping threat. Mexico is missing long-term absentees Marcel Ruiz (ACL) and Luis Malagón (Achilles), but their depth is superior. Captain Edson Álvarez remains a minor doubt and may be rested given Mexico has already qualified.
